Well, I received a lot of answers this week. I think most of all with my faith and how I need to trust more in Christ. I also have understood the atonement like never before. I finally read the talk that Anna gave me a long time ago that is called In the Strength of the Lord by Bednar. Oh my gosh, it totally changed my understanding of the atonement. It's not just for those who need to repent but for those who are doing good. We can accomplish things that we could not do ourselves through the atonement of Christ. It says many times that the people were strengthened in the Lord and they were able to do many amazing things that an ordinary man could not do. I really am praying so hard to be able to apply this part of the atonement into the work and into my life. I can set goals that I could not achieve by myself. But I know that after all I can do the atonement of the Lord will come in and do the rest. He talked about how grace is the power by which we can accomplish amazing things. And this grace came about through the atonement of Christ. I am so thankful to understand more fully the atonement. It gives me a desire to help everyone else to understand.
